ホームページ > バックエンド開発 > PHPの問題 > yum delete php が失敗した場合の対処方法

yum delete php が失敗した場合の対処方法

藏色散人
リリース: 2023-03-10 09:08:02
オリジナル
2741 人が閲覧しました

Yum delete php が失敗した解決策: 1. "#rpm -qa|grep php" コマンドを使用して強制的に削除します; 2. 正しいアンインストール シーケンスを変更します; 3. "#php -v" を使用して削除を確認します十分です。

yum delete php が失敗した場合の対処方法

この記事の動作環境: linux5.9.8 システム、PHP5.1.6 バージョン、DELL G3 コンピューター

php バージョン コマンドを確認します。

#php -v
ログイン後にコピー
ログイン後にコピー

このコマンドは削除するには問題ありません

#yum remove php
ログイン後にコピー

このコマンドを使用した後、再度使用するとバージョン情報が表示されるためです

#php -v
ログイン後にコピー
ログイン後にコピー

。 。 。 。 。

強制的に削除する必要があります

#rpm -qa|grep php
ログイン後にコピー

プロンプトは次のとおりです

#php-pdo-5.1.6-27.el5_5.3
#php-mysql-5.1.6-27.el5_5.3
#php-xml-5.1.6-27.el5_5.3
#php-cli-5.1.6-27.el5_5.3
#php-common-5.1.6-27.el5_5.3
#php-gd-5.1.6-27.el5_5.3
ログイン後にコピー

依存関係のないものを最初にアンインストールするように注意してください

pdoはmysqlの依存関係です; common は gd の依存関係です;

例如:# rpm -e php-pdo-5.1.6-27.el5_5.3
error: Failed dependencies:
php-pdo is needed by (installed) php-mysql-5.1.6-27.el5_5.3.i386
ログイン後にコピー

したがって 正しいアンインストール シーケンスは次のとおりです:

# rpm -e php-mysql-5.1.6-27.el5_5.3
# rpm -e php-pdo-5.1.6-27.el5_5.3
# rpm -e php-xml-5.1.6-27.el5_5.3
# rpm -e php-cli-5.1.6-27.el5_5.3
# rpm -e php-gd-5.1.6-27.el5_5.3
# rpm -e php-common-5.1.6-27.el5_5.3
ログイン後にコピー

Reuse # php -v

ありませんバージョン情報を表示するためのプロンプト

最新の PHP をインストールします

wget
tar xzvf php-5.3.6.tar.gz
cd php-5.3.6
./configure --prefix=/usr/local/php
ログイン後にコピー

推奨学習:「PHP ビデオ チュートリアル

以上がyum delete php が失敗した場合の対処方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
php
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
最新の問題
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ート